Graduates of the Rosalind Franklin Master of Science in Biomedical Science program will be prepared to pursue a medical career. You will be assigned a faculty advisor and everything will be done to ensure your success.
This program begins in mid-August and ends in mid-May.

Grading for this biomedical science program is conducted using the A/B/C scale and you will need to earn at least a 3.0 in your certificate coursework.
There are no interviews for this program.
To enhance your chances at admission you are encouraged to submit additional materials such as resumes, abstracts of research work or published papers, and any additional items which will be useful in evaluating your application.
Deadline
Applications are due on June 15th. Applications are available beginning Oct. 15th of each year.
